The purpose is threefold.
First, it weeds out any CA that has reported your account without any REAL assignment or authorization from the OC.
Second, it weeds out accounts that were written off, or discounted by the OC and are not valid.
Third, IF the account is verified, it gives you the data you need to pay the OC with the HIPAA letter.
